MBS in Industrial Relations & Human Resource Management





The objective of the MBS in Industrial Relations and Human Resource Management is to develop a critical and applied approach to people management. In particular, the programme will provide students with:

� a thorough knowledge and applied competence in the fundamentals of industrial relations and human resource management, and their interfaces;

� a critical understanding of the theoretical principles underpinning IR & HRM;

� an ability to analyse the social, economic and political factors that influence the way people are managed;

� a critical knowledge base in the specialist fields of organisational development and change management; employee relations, human resource consultancy, employment law, reward, and training, innovation and learning;

� the skills to prepare a dissertation, and produce valid conclusions in both written format and oral presentations.
